The Eight Pillars of The ZENWEALTH 8 Pillars Framework™
Budget & Savings
The first pillar of The ZENWEALTH 8 Pillars Framework™ focuses on building awareness of cash flow and establishing disciplined savings habits.
Understanding how income, spending, and savings interact helps individuals build financial structure.
Credit
Credit plays an important role in financial opportunity.
This pillar examines how credit history may influence borrowing capacity, interest rates, and financial flexibility.
College & Future Funding
Planning for education and major life milestones requires thoughtful coordination.
Within The ZENWEALTH 8 Pillars Framework™, education planning is approached in a way that supports opportunity without compromising long-term financial stability.
Debt & Loan Management
Understanding interest structures and repayment strategies is essential.
Debt management helps individuals reduce financial pressure and maintain financial flexibility over time.
Estate Planning Awareness
Estate planning awareness includes understanding beneficiary designations, trust concepts, and generational planning principles.
This pillar supports coordinated wealth transition strategies.
Financial Literacy & Psychology
Financial decisions are often influenced by behavior and emotional responses.
This pillar encourages awareness of financial habits and disciplined decision-making.
Financial Protection
Protecting financial progress is an important component of financial planning.
This pillar explores risk management concepts such as life insurance, health coverage, and financial protection strategies.
Retirement Income Sustainability
The final pillar focuses on coordinating income strategies for retirement.
Within The ZENWEALTH 8 Pillars Framework™, retirement planning considers longevity, taxes, healthcare costs, and income sustainability.
